Source author record

Toshinori Suzuki

Toshinori Suzuki appears in the imported research catalog. Authorship, coauthor and topic links are available while profile ownership is still unclaimed.

ResearcherUnclaimed source record

Catalog footprint

What is connected

3works
4topics
4close collaborators

Actions

Connect this record

Log in to claim

Research graph

See the researcher in context

Open full explorer

Inspect adjacent papers, topics, institutions and collaborators without losing the researcher page.

Building this map preview

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

3 published item(s)

preprint2020arXiv

Femtosecond X-ray emission study of the spin cross-over dynamics in haem proteins

In haemoglobin (consisting of four globular myoglobin-like subunits), the change from the low-spin (LS) hexacoordinated haem to the high spin (HS) pentacoordinated domed form upon ligand detachment and the reverse process upon ligand binding, represent the transition states that ultimately drive the respiratory function. Visible-ultraviolet light has long been used to mimic the ligand release from the haem by photodissociation, while its recombination was monitored using time-resolved infrared to ultraviolet spectroscopic tools. However, these are neither element- nor spin-sensitive. Here we investigate the transition state in the case of Myoglobin-NO (MbNO) using femtosecond Fe Kalpha and Kbeta non-resonant X-ray emission spectroscopy (XES) at an X-ray free-electron laser upon photolysis of the Fe-NO bond. We find that the photoinduced change from the LS (S = 1/2) MbNO to the HS (S = 2) deoxy-myoglobin (deoxyMb) haem occurs in ca. 800 fs, and that it proceeds via an intermediate (S = 1) spin state. The XES observables also show that upon NO recombination to deoxyMb, the return to the planar MbNO ground state is an electronic relaxation from HS to LS taking place in ca. 30 ps. Thus, the entire ligand dissociation-recombination cycle in MbNO is a spin cross-over followed by a reverse spin cross-over process.

preprint2016arXiv

Crashing Modulus Attack on Modular Squaring for Rabin Cryptosystem

The Rabin cryptosystem has been proposed protect the unique ID (UID) in radio-frequency identification tags. The Rabin cryptosystem is a type of lightweight public key system that is theoretetically quite secure; however it is vulnerable to several side-channel attacks. In this paper, a crashing modulus attack is presented as a new fault attack on modular squaring during Rabin encryption. This attack requires only one fault in the public key if its perturbed public key can be factored. Our simulation results indicate that the attack is more than 50\% successful with several faults in practical time. A complicated situation arises when reconstrucing the message, including the UID, from ciphertext, i.e., the message and the perturbed public key are not relatively prime. We present a complete and mathematically rigorous message reconstruction algorithm for such a case. Moreover, we propose an exact formula to obtain a number of candidate messages. We show that the number is not generally equal to a power of two.

preprint2014arXiv

Double Counting in $2^t$-ary RSA Precomputation Reveals the Secret Exponent

A new fault attack, double counting attack (DCA), on the precomputation of $2^t$-ary modular exponentiation for a classical RSA digital signature (i.e., RSA without the Chinese remainder theorem) is proposed. The $2^t$-ary method is the most popular and widely used algorithm to speed up the RSA signature process. Developers can realize the fastest signature process by choosing optimum $t$. For example, $t=6$ is optimum for a 1536-bit classical RSA implementation. The $2^t$-ary method requires precomputation to generate small exponentials of message. Conventional fault attack research has paid little attention to precomputation, even though precomputation could be a target of a fault attack. The proposed DCA induces faults in precomputation by using instruction skip technique, which is equivalent to replacing an instruction with a no operation in assembly language. This paper also presents a useful "position checker" tool to determine the position of the $2^t$-ary coefficients of the secret exponent from signatures based on faulted precomputations. The DCA is demonstrated to be an effective attack method for some widely used parameters. DCA can reconstruct an entire secret exponent using the position checker with $63(=2^6-1)$ faulted signatures in a short time for a 1536-bit RSA implementation using the $2^6$-ary method. The DCA process can be accelerated for a small public exponent (e.g., 65537). The the best of our knowledge, the proposed DCA is the first fault attack against classical RSA precomputation.